Yeah that would be a neat way to expand product storage and handling options. Too bad. Would also have been nice to be able to connect things to the headquarters in Reunion so that production needs to build ships could be met automatically. I think the issue is that these unusual stations weren't designed with connection points for inclusion in a complex. Their unusual mix of capabilities may have presented some programming challenges to simply adding them to a complex. For instance, if the equipment dock now allows you to dock TL's to your complex, where do they go? How does the game ensure another part of the complex doesn't block the docking area? These additional issues probably weren't worth solving just to allow the incorporation of such unusual station types into complexes.

Neither trading stations nor equipment docks can be used for much, except parking ships (teladi trading station does make a nice firebase though).

Theoretically, you could drop a trading station in a sector and add all the wares used by every system in a 2-4 jump radius, then set up CAGs to buy/sell those goods, which should generate some profit and help keep the local economy afloat. If you produce those goods you could even set up a CLS or 2 to transfer those goods from your production point to the trading station, so your CAGs are only selling, thus making more profit. I think some of the regulars on the ES boards have done this, but I've not tried it myself.

EqDs are largely useless though, park a couple of capital size ships at them and you're kinda done. I suppose you could try the same thing as with the Trading Station, but the EqDs seem to hold a tiny amount of stock.

What makes equipment docks particularly useful as firebases is the fact that when you dock your capital ship with yours, it can be used to recharge the shields instantly, instead of having to wait (in Reunion, up to an hour) for shields to recharge. I plan on using them this way to wage continuous war in enemy sectors.
